  • Patent number: 10915490
    Abstract: Systems and methods for providing audio streams over peripheral component interconnect (PCI) express (PCIE) links are disclosed. In particular, exemplary aspects of the present disclosure are used to calculate an uplink timing requirement and adjust a margin time before a modem encodes audio data so that the encoding is done before data is transmitted to an external network. Further aspects of the present disclosure allow a first integrated circuit (IC) to synchronize its clock with that of the modem.

  • Patent number: 10508398
    Abstract: An installation guide with quick release for installation of a piece of equipment, comprises a base member adapted to be fixed at a predetermined location, the base member having a cavity, an engagement member adapted to be received into the cavity of the base member, a latching mechanism adapted to latch the engagement member with the base member, the latching mechanism including a release line attached with the engagement member and a guide line attached with the engagement member. Further, the latching mechanism is adapted to release the engagement member from the base member on actuation of the release line.

  • Patent number: 10507894
    Abstract: There is provided a self-restoring motion compensating mooring system for a floating unit. The mooring system includes a plurality of mooring anchors, a plurality of top fairleads attached near the top edges of the floating unit, a plurality of bottom fairleads attached near bottom edges of the floating unit, a stabilizer, a plurality of mooring cables passing through the respective top and bottom fairleads, connected between the plurality of mooring anchors and the stabilizer. Further, in respective equilibrium positions of the floating unit and the stabilizer, the center of gravity of the stabilizer is located directly below the center of gravity of the floating unit.

  • Patent number: 10462269
    Abstract: Aspects disclosed in the detailed description include packetizing encoded audio frames into compressed-over-pulse code modulation (PCM) (COP) packets for transmission over PCM interfaces. In one aspect, a COP packetizing circuit is configured to receive an encoded audio frame generated from a PCM frame, and generate a COP packet that includes the encoded audio frame irrespective of the audio format. The COP packet is generated with a packet length proportional to a PCM length of the PCM frame, allowing the COP packetizing circuit to transmit the COP packet over an isochronous PCM interface with a lower bit rate than the PCM frame to reduce power. The COP packetizing circuit provides a mobile computing device with a single packetizing scheme that supports multiple audio formats, and allows for reducing power through bit rate scaling.
